Team
Dr. Mikel Aramberri
Dr. Mikel Aramberri Gutiérrez is a leading specialist in traumatology, member of the medical team of Real Madrid and medical coordinator of the Medical Service of the National Rugby Team.
He is particularly adept at treatments such as recurrent shoulder dislocation and arthroscopic bony reconstruction of severe instabilities. Great experience in supraspinatus tears, acromioclavicular arthropathy, calcific tendinitis of the supraspinatus, cruciate ligament rupture and osteoarthritis of the shoulder / knee.
Dr. Fernando Aranda Romero
He has extensive experience in the field of hand surgery, peripheral nerve and wrist arthroscopy.
During the years 2013 and 2014, he was part of the prestigious team of Reconstructive Surgery of Dr. Cavadas in Valencia.
He is responsible for the Hand and Peripheral Nerve Surgery Unit of the traumatology team ALAI Sports Medicine Clinic of Dr. Aramberri.
He has published in national and international journals and is co-founder of the International Society of Orthoplastic Surgery (ISOPS).
